Key Considerations: Medical Debt & Settlement Cash-Out in Louisiana
Medical debt is the #1 reason cited in court petitions for settlement transfers
Courts generally view medical emergencies favorably when evaluating best interest
Partial sales can cover immediate medical costs while preserving future payments
Hospital payment plans and charity care should be explored first
Medical debt rarely accrues interest above 0-2%, making it cheaper than discount rates
The No Surprises Act (2022) provides additional protections against surprise billing
Selling at a 12%+ discount rate to pay 0% medical debt is usually a poor financial trade

Medical Debt & Settlement Cash-Out Settlement Sales in Louisiana: What You Need to Know
If you are dealing with medical debt issues in Louisiana and considering selling your structured settlement, understanding the intersection of medical debt considerations and Louisiana's settlement laws is essential. Louisiana's SSPA, enacted in 2001, requires court approval to ensure any sale is in your best interest.
Louisiana has 10 active buyers competing for structured settlement payments. The average discount rate is 12.8%, though rates as low as 9.5% are available. Court approval typically takes 45-70 days. Louisiana requires independent professional advice before completing a transfer.
